Understanding Wall Painting Machines and Wallpaper: Key Differences
Fundamental Principles and Operational Methods
Digital wall painting machines use precise inkjet technology to print on vertical surfaces directly with special inks. They do this by using track-based moving devices. These automatic systems use high-resolution print heads that are controlled by complex software. This makes it possible to reproduce graphics with great accuracy and detail. Calibrated ink supply methods keep the pressure and flow rates the same across the whole surface area during the printing process. In traditional wallpaper placement, glue is used to apply the wallpaper and it is placed by hand. For vinyl, fabric, and peel-and-stick materials to line up correctly, the base needs to be prepared, measurements need to be exact, and skilled work is needed. To work at its best, the glue bonding process needs certain external conditions, such as controlled humidity and temperature levels.

Durability and Performance Analysis
UV-resistant ink formulas and protective layers that keep colors true for longer amounts of time make advanced wall painting machines last longer. Since there are no adhesive layers, there are no typical failure places like edge lifting or water getting in, which can happen when wallpaper is being installed. How long wallpaper lasts depends a lot on what kind of material it is made of and how well it was installed. Commercial-grade options are very resistant to damage and cleaning methods, while cheaper options may need to be replaced more often in places with a lot of use.
Performance and Efficiency Comparison: Wall Painting Machines vs Wallpaper
Operational Speed and Labor Requirements
Through automatic application processes, digital printing technology cuts project timelines by a large amount. wall printer can cover a lot of space in a lot less time than it takes to hang wallpaper by hand. When compared to traditional methods, this method cuts down on work by about 60% because it doesn't require pattern matching, glue application, or seam alignment. For good results, wallpaper installation needs to be done by trained professionals, especially when working with complicated patterns or uneven surfaces. The way wallpaper is applied (in a certain order) makes it harder to get things done quickly, especially when multiple design copies or custom sizes are needed.

Maintenance, Safety, and Operational Tips for Wall Painting Machines
Essential Maintenance Protocols
Cleaning wall painting machines on a regular basis keeps the quality of the prints high and extends their life. Every day, maintenance tasks like cleaning the print heads, clearing the ink system, and lubricating the tracks keep the machine running smoothly. Inspections done once a week make sure that the setting is correct and find any wear parts that need to be fixed. Preventive upkeep includes deep cleaning once a month, checking accuracy every three months, and replacing parts once a year. Keeping good records helps with guarantee compliance and troubleshooting when operating problems happen.

Operational Best Practices
The best ink for wall painting machines relies on the features of the substrate and the environment. Water-based formulas work well for most indoor uses, while UV-curable formulas make high-wear surfaces last longer. When ink is stored and rotated properly, it doesn't break down over time, which ensures quality. To get even covering, the spray method needs optimization with the right standoff distances, consistent speeds, and overlap patterns. Environmental controls, such as managing temperature and humidity, make the best conditions for printing and stop application errors.

FAQ
1. Which option provides better cost-effectiveness for large commercial projects?
Wall painting machines typically deliver superior cost-effectiveness for projects exceeding 1,000 square feet due to reduced labor requirements and faster application speeds. The breakeven point varies based on local labor costs and equipment availability, but most commercial installations benefit from automated printing technology.
2. What maintenance intervals are recommended for printing equipment?
Daily cleaning and weekly calibration checks maintain optimal performance, while monthly deep cleaning cycles and quarterly component inspections prevent major issues. Annual service intervals should include comprehensive calibration verification and wear component replacement based on usage patterns.
3. Which surfaces are compatible with both decoration methods?
Most interior surfaces including drywall, concrete, wood, and previously painted surfaces accommodate both applications. However, wall painting machines offer superior versatility on irregular surfaces and materials that may not support adhesive bonding required for wallpaper installation.
